2

我已经在 win 7 上安装了 python 和 django。两者都可以在命令行中正常运行。我证明了这一点,import django然后得到了版本print django.get_version()。在这一步之后,我从 Eclipse 的更新页面安装了 pydev。我在首选项窗口中自动配置了 python 路径。但是,当我创建一个 python 项目时,我得到:

在此处输入图像描述

在这里您可以看到创建了一个“空”项目。但是我研究了两个应该定义的变量:

DJANGO_MANAGE_LOCATIONDJANGO_SETTINGS_MODULE

但是我得到:

在此处输入图像描述

因此我的问题是:

新建django项目时如何设置manage.py获取django结构?

更新

好的,伙计们,我想出了解决方案:

  1. 在 pydev 中创建一个项目
  2. 用 django 创建一个项目
  3. pydev 和 django 项目应该具有相同的名称
  4. 将项目复制到eclipse工作区并按F5
  5. 玩得开心;)
4

1 回答 1

0

我昨天刚做了这个,遇到了同样的问题。我必须django-admin.py startproject [projectname]从项目工作区目录中的命令行运行才能自动生成所有文件。完成此操作后,您需要将项目配置设置为什么是不言而喻的(将在项目目录中生成一个 manage.py 和 settings.py 文件,您只需提供一个相对路径到 manage.py 和相应项目配置字段中设置的包路径)。

于 2013-01-31T12:50:14.083 回答